    Edgar Wallace

    Richard Horatio Edgar Wallace (April 1, 1875 – February 10, 1932) was an English crime writer, journalist, novelist, screenwriter, and playwright, who wrote 175 novels, 24 plays, and numerous articles in newspapers and journals.     Lorenzo Semple Jr.

    Lorenzo Semple Jr. (born 1923) is an American screenwriter and sometime playwright, best known for his work on the campy television series Batman and the political/paranoia movie thrillers The Parallax View (1974) and Three Days of the Condor (1975).   • James Ashmore Creelman

    James Ashmore Creelman (September 21, 1894 in Marietta, Ohio – 18 September 1941 in New York City) was an early Hollywood film writer.   • Suzanne Jacob

    Suzanne Jacob (born 1943) is a Canadian novelist, poet, playwright, singer-songwriter, and critic.
